7. Vince McMahon Gave Mr. Fuji 10K Without A Thought

Kevin Kelly had another awesome story to share on Jericho's pod from his time working in WWE between 1996-2003.

One day, Curt Hennig approached he and Dave Hebner in Knoxville, Tennessee to tell them he'd seen Mr. Fuji working in a local movie theatre. When Dave heard the news, he was shocked, and he immediately suggested they go to tell Vince about it. Kelly put the thought out of his head and continued working.

Later, Hennig told him that McMahon, without hesitation, stuffed $10,000 into a nearby envelope and instructed him to "take it to Fuji". This was part of a segment on Talk Is Jericho that had Y2J and Kelly discussing the guys Vince wanted to take care of for life. Fuji, a long time servant who had once worked for his father, was one of those men.

McMahon didn't give the 10K idea a second thought. To Kelly, that said everything; cynics reading this might be tempted to wonder if Hennig, a notorious ribber, was up to his old tricks and fancied a cash bonus. Surely not.
